#933229 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#933229 is composed of 57.6% red, 19.6% green and 16.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 66% magenta, 72.1%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 5.1 degrees, a saturation of 56.4% and a lightness of 36.9%. #933229 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6452 with #270000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

#933229 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#933229 has RGB values of R:147, G:50, B:41 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.66, Y:0.72,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 9646633.

Hex triplet 933229 #933229
RGB Decimal 147, 50, 41 rgb(147,50,41)
RGB Percent 57.6, 19.6, 16.1 rgb(57.6%,19.6%,16.1%)
CMYK 0, 66, 72, 42
HSL 5.1°, 56.4, 36.9 hsl(5.1,56.4%,36.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 5.1°, 72.1, 57.6
Web Safe 993333 #993333
CIE-LAB 35.293, 40.261, 27.685
XYZ 13.574, 8.646, 3.052
xyY 0.537, 0.342, 8.646
CIE-LCH 35.293, 48.861, 34.514
CIE-LUV 35.293, 72.674, 19.356
Hunter-Lab 29.404, 30.947, 14.429
Binary 10010011, 00110010, 00101001

Shades and Tints of #933229

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090302 is the darkest color, while #fdf9f9 is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#933229 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#4e4e4e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#5c4847 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#635b3e Protanopia 1% of men
  • #70572d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#993b3e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#744c36 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#7d4a2b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#963736 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
